Rabat's Commitment to Urban Safety
The city of Rabat has prioritized the urgent project aimed at securing the cliffs that overlook the Bouregreg River. This initiative comes in response to the increasing risks associated with erosion, landslides, and potential collapses, particularly during periods of heavy rainfall. By reinforcing these sensitive areas, the capital city not only aims to protect vital infrastructure but also seeks to enhance the resilience of its urban fabric against environmental challenges.
Technical Discussions and Project Implementation
In a recent working meeting dedicated to the protection of the cliffs and slopes along the Bouregreg River, Rabat's municipality has accelerated its efforts in this crucial area. The gathering focused on the technical and engineering aspects of the project, which has now been classified as one of the capital's top priorities. During this meeting, a comprehensive study conducted by the consulting firm overseeing the project was presented, attended by officials from the Bouregreg Valley Development Agency. Discussions revolved around the various phases of implementation and the strategies proposed to secure the slopes and mitigate the erosion effects observed at specific sites overlooking the valley.
